"Navigating Your Advancement Career"
Read the summary from this program
Speaker: Amy Bronson, Director of Recruitment and Professional Training at Boston University
Due to the recent economic downturn, advancement professionals are recasting their career outlook as the not for profit world experiences tremendous change in staffing and organizational development. With ongoing recovery, many institutions are again hiring and professionals need to be savvier than ever to make sure they are making the right move to the right institution at the right time. Managing your advancement career is more important than ever in this changing landscape. Amy will talk about navigating your advancement career, including how to approach a job search as well as managing your career growth in your current organization. In her interactive presentation, Amy will discuss career goals and paths, finding the right fit in the current job market, and will cover topics from informal networking and mentoring to landing the right offer.
Amy Bronson is Director of Recruitment and Professional Training at Boston University, where she is engaged in building an outstanding team of advancement professionals who are undertaking an enormous challenge: the first comprehensive campaign in the history of the University. Prior to joining BU in September 2010, Amy lead the strategic staffing initiative for the Light the World Campaign at Boston College, managing the recruitment effort and everything from onboarding to succession planning for over 100 new staff for the Office of University Advancement. Before joining BC in 2005, Amy was at Harvard Law School where her many roles included working in special events; curriculum planning and program administration for executive legal education and as a fundraiser and administrator at Baker House Alumni Center. Her prior experience includes working for Tiffany & Co. in Chicago and Houston and teaching in Athens, Greece. With over 15 years of advancement experience, Amy has presented for many organizations, most recently joining the faculty for the CASE Strategic Management Conference in Boston March 28-30.
